ADAS Systems Engineer

Onsite in New Philadelphia, OH

System Engineer will be responsible for leading the development of various ADAS features including functional architecture & decomposition, requirement authoring and allocation, traceability, compliance, and end-to-end verification and validation.

Job Descriptions

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ES

           The Systems Engineer (SE) is a lead position who is responsible for the technical integrity, quality, and on-time delivery of their feature

           The System Engineer duties include the development of functional architecture & decomposition, system/feature requirements, design, integration, and test

           The SE is responsible for the planning, preparation, and execution of all design related gate reviews with support from component and software engineers

           Provides Systems Engineering leadership to the other functional areas

           Responsible for all SE feature planning on the project including test and verification plan

           Design and develop the feature architecture, interfaces, and design including commonality considerations

           Ensure the system, subsystem, and component interfaces are maintained

           Responsible for adherence to compliance requirements (ISO26262/ASIL, FMVSS, etc.)

           Identify, define, and manage power, data, and other system interfaces; manage power and network bandwidth allocations for vehicle functions

           Decompose system performance and verification requirements and develop design verification plans & reports

           Ensure the design has been fully defined, traceable, and validated during testing down to the components and software

           Define and execute system and subsystem integration, test, and verification plans on BB/HIL/SIL/Vehicle

QUALIFICATIONS AND EDUCATION REQUIREMENTS

           Bachelors Degree in a technical discipline (e.g., engineering, math, physics) with a minimum 5 years of applicable experience, fewer years required with an advanced degree

           Strong skills in system/subsystem requirements development, design, and test

           Ability to develop a system model within SysML tools (e.g., MagicDraw, Rhapsody, Visio)

           Must be able to conduct and write test procedures & reports

           Highly motivated performer

           Ability to make decisions in a fast-paced dynamic environment

           Must be able to work occasional evening and/or weekend overtime as required

           Strong commun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ills is required

           Able to work in office, shop, test lab, test site environments, and in vehicles

           Hands-on experience in development of automotive electrical system and hardware

PREFERRED EXPERIENCE AND SKILLS

           Experience with Model Based System Engineering (MBSE) and the ability to lead the development of MBSE implementation

           Knowledge of high-voltage and low-voltage electrical system design, safety, EMI, EMC, HVIL

           Understanding of high voltage energy storage and charge systems for EVs
